Output 66c07af17a7e7f88bfa5d29df297ed8fcf722889b7bab5449ec758029c138ebd:3

value
44462317
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c02891bc822a5a475d70948f22e50decd2524f22fd47788c2eba62026d15e55
address
tb1pmspgjx7gy2j6gawhp9y0ytjsmmxj2f8j9l280zxzawnzqfk3te2sdntr4z
transaction
66c07af17a7e7f88bfa5d29df297ed8fcf722889b7bab5449ec758029c138ebd
confirmations
68720
spent
true